Pending budgetary approval, the College of Engineering and Science at
Louisiana Tech
University anticipates filling one Visiting Assistant Professor position in
statistics. This position
may be considered for joint appointment between the Programs of
Mathematics/Statistics and
Industrial Engineering, commencing September 1, 2019. A Ph.D. in
Statistics, Mathematics,
Industrial Engineering, or related field by the time of appointment as well
as excellent teaching
and research credentials are required.

The Programs of Mathematics/Statistics and Industrial Engineering are
housed in the College of
Engineering and Science, whose vision is to be a world leader in
integrating engineering and
science in education and research. The College is experiencing significant
growth in several
program areas and is undertaking an aggressive faculty recruiting campaign
to attract culturally
and academically diverse faculty of the highest caliber. Construction of a
new $40M integrated
engineering and science education building providing the College an
additional 128,000 square
feet of educational space is underway with an anticipated occupancy for
Fall 2019. To build a
diverse workforce the college encourages applications from individuals with
disabilities, minorities, veterans and women. The University is a doctoral
granting public institution that
enrolls approximately 13,000 students from 48 states and 69 countries.

The Program of Mathematics/Statistics offers a B.S. and a M.S. degree and
is a major participant in the interdisciplinary Ph.D. program in
Computational Analysis and Modeling. The Program of Industrial Engineering
offers a B.S., M.S. in Engineering – Industrial Engineering concentration,
and M.S. in Engineering and Technology Management. The Industrial
Engineering Program also contributes to a wide range of Ph.D. programs
